In this episode of Her Journey Home, I’m joined by Courtney Andersen, sober coach, podcast host, and author of Sober Vibes, for an honest conversation about sobriety, identity, and what it truly means to change your life. Courtney shares her ten-year journey with alcohol, the moment she knew moderation was no longer working, and the decision that ultimately led her to sobriety.
We talk about the realities of the first 90 days, grieving the loss of an old identity, and learning how to socialize, have fun, and feel confident without alcohol. This episode is for anyone questioning their relationship with drinking, feeling stuck in the cycle of moderation, or looking for reassurance that sobriety isn’t about restriction—it’s about freedom, clarity, and coming home to yourself.
In This Episode, We Discuss:
- Why moderation often keeps people stuck in the drinking cycle
- The emotional process of grieving alcohol and past identities
- Tools for navigating the first 90 days of sobriety
- How to socialize and build confidence without alcohol
- Why sobriety is a mindset shift, not a loss
